-13=7y+64solve and show process

−13=7y+64

Step 1: Flip the equation.

7y+64=−13

Step 2: Subtract 64 from both sides.

7y+64−64=−13−64

7y=−77

Step 3: Divide both sides by 7.

7y

7

=

−77

7

y=−11

Sam has $140 to shop with… He wants to buy a pair of jeans that cost $45 and then some rings. The Rings cost $16 each. If Sam pu
m_a_m_a [10]

Answer:

5 rings

Step-by-step explanation:

sam can only buy 5 rings because each ring cost $16 and after he bought the jeans which cost $45 it left him with only $95. so if you times 16 and 5 it gives you 80 and if you times 16 and 6 it gives you 96 but sam only had $95 left so he could only buy 5 which cost him $80. that left him with an extra $15.
